Within Problem‑Solving Skills, you’ll find roles such as Data Analyst, Business Process Analyst, Operations Research Analyst, Quality Assurance Engineer, and ML Ops Engineer. Typical responsibilities include building SQL and Python pipelines, designing A/B tests, modeling supply‑chain bottlenecks, and deploying containerized analytics services on Kubernetes. Each position requires a blend of statistical rigor, technical fluency, and the ability to translate findings into clear business recommendations.
